Job Summary
We are looking for an energetic, reliable, and caring Floater to join our team! This role supports multiple classrooms and helps maintain a safe, positive learning environment for our students.
What we’re looking for: • Dependable and flexible team player • Positive attitude and love for working with children • Ability to work well with staff and students of different age groups
Key Responsibilities: • Assist lead teachers with daily classroom activities • Supervise and engage with children during learning and play • Help maintain a clean, organized classroom • Step into different classrooms as needed to provide support • Ensure children’s safety and follow center policies
Qualifications:
High school diploma or GED
Ability to pass a state and federal background check
A year of previous teaching assistant experience preferred
High-energy with a love of working with children
Organized and detail-oriented
